[css] 一个页面引用多个文件,如何防止样式冲突?

编码层面:
1、定制规则:不同的样式文件表,增加不同的前缀。
2、按照功能区分文件:不同的文件样式表,针对页面不同的部分写样式,通过样式层级的方式,确认样式的边界。(例如header部分:#header p { },footer部分:#footer p { })。工具层面:
1、postCss的使用
2、vue中scoped、react中的css module配置等等

个人简介

我是歌谣,欢迎和大家一起交流前后端知识。放弃很容易,
但坚持一定很酷。欢迎大家一起讨论

主目录

与歌谣一起通关前端面试题

[css] 一个页面引用多个文件,如何防止样式冲突?相关推荐

  1. Web项目中前端页面引用外部Js和Css的路径问题

    公众号:南宫一梦 Web项目中前端页面引用外部Js和Css的路径问题 一般我们在做Web项目时,通常会将多个页面引入的公共js和css文件抽取出来,单独写成一个公共文件,以期方便各个页面单独引入,达到 ...

  2. 页面引用CSS和Javascript时,内联和外置的区别

    CSS在实际应用中,一般有以下三种级联方式. 1. 外联式 外联式样式表中,CSS 代码作为文件单独存放,如以 style.css 文件包含所有样式.在 HTML 中的外部级联采用 <link& ...

  3. Css基本语法及页面引用

    Css基本语法及页面引用 CSS代码出现在三个地方 </head><body><b style='....'>兄弟连</b> <!-- 1. 行内 ...

  4. Spring Boot 项目的jsp页面引用css、js、img、fonts的问题解决

    Spring Boot 项目的jsp页面引用css.js.img.fonts的问题解决 我在刚开始用Spring Boot 写招聘网站时,jsp页面写好了,代码逻辑写好了,css.js.img.fon ...

  5. 从零开始开发一个vue组件打包并发布到npm (把vue组件打包成一个可以直接引用的js文件)

    自己写的组件 有的也挺好的,为了方便以后用自己再用或者给别人用,把组件打包发布到npm是最好不过了,本次打包支持 支持正常的组件调用方式,也支持Vue.use, 也可以直接引用打包好的js文件, 配合 ...

  6. [html] 对于写一个页面布局,html/css/js这三者你是先写哪个后写哪个?

    [html] 对于写一个页面布局,html/css/js这三者你是先写哪个后写哪个? 快捷键创建模板html+css写出结构写js做交互 个人简介 我是歌谣,欢迎和大家一起交流前后端知识.放弃很容易, ...

  7. [css] 移动页面底部工具条有3个图标,如何平分?在设置边框后最后一个图标掉下去了怎么办?

    [css] 移动页面底部工具条有3个图标,如何平分?在设置边框后最后一个图标掉下去了怎么办? flex-wrap nowrap, 一般flex默认就是nowrap white-space:nowrap ...

  8. 微信公众号Web页面CSS文件里面的样式不加载

    问题描述:微信公众号Web页面CSS文件里面的样式不加载,但在浏览器中打开是可以正常加载CSS文件里面的样式的 解决办法:微信页面的缓存是十分严重的,即使清除了移动设备(手机)上该应用的缓存,有时也是 ...

  9. html怎么引用php文件,html页面怎么跟php文件连接

    HTML页面调用PHP文件的方法是要通过JavaScript来实现,在生成静态页面时,可以根据数据库id给html页面生成一个对应的JavaScript文件来调用PHP文件. HTML页面调用PHP文 ...

最新文章

  1. 在MyEclipse中使用maven创建web项目
  2. 自然语言处理NLP-100例 | 第三篇:骚扰短信识别 MultinomialNB实现(内附源码)
  3. DOCKER OVERLAY2占用大量磁盘空间解决办法
  4. OHCI,UHCI,EOHCI,XHCI
  5. java gc日志乱码_gc原理以及gc日志剖析
  6. 意法半导体(ST)新充电器芯片减少穿戴和便携式产品的成本和上市时间
  7. fromPromise
  8. windows xp下Apache2.2.11整合Tomcat6.0.20
  9. Mocha BSM产品亮点——SNMP Trap的支持
  10. 测试用例设计方法--正交表法(工具allpairs)
  11. 从键盘输入10个整数,求其平均值
  12. 数据导入与预处理-第8章-实战演练-数据分析师岗位分析
  13. js监听只读文本框_js设置input文本框只读
  14. [附源码]计算机毕业设计JAVA濒危物种科普系统
  15. 职场上,怎么对待那些总是以领导口吻给自己安排工作的同事
  16. html如何给header添加token,将Token添加到请求头Header中
  17. 5分钟带你看懂区块链浏览器
  18. 怎么做精准引流?如何精准引流加粉?怎样引流被加精准粉?
  19. weblogic启动报错:BEA-149265 Stack trace for mess...
  20. Facebook Hacker Cup 2015 Round 1--Corporate Gifting(树形动态规划)

热门文章

  1. 捷克 签证_一位捷克开发人员构建了可在您的浏览器中直接运行的语音合成器
  2. idea 启动界面导入项目_如何为您的项目启动有效的登录页面
  3. 内置函数isinstance和issubclass
  4. 灾难 BZOJ 2815
  5. iOS 10 的一个重要更新-自定义的通知界面
  6. 单交换机VLAN 配置和结果验证(51cto-o8)
  7. Eclipse换常用的快捷键
  8. ArcGIS Server for JavaScript 3.3 的安装部署
  9. 《计算机应用基础》18春作业,【北语网院】18春《计算机应用基础》作业_2.pdf...
  10. python初始化函数_当你学会了Python爬虫,网上的图片素材就免费了